Does Life Return To Normal After Tumor And Kidney Surgery?

hi doctor
my husben did a surery to remove a tumour and part of the kidney before one month . the tumour zise wa 7.5 cm . my Q he and me very worry about his life dose he will live normal and have long life if the od said or it is only 5 years as we hear .

Urologist 's  Response
Hello and welcome to HCM.
As an Urologist,i can understand your anxiety.
Life is normal after tumor surgery,if the stage of tumor is early.
You haven't sent details about the biopsy of the tumor.
Neither have you sent the details of the scan done before surgery.
So it's difficult to comment,without knowing the stage.
If the stage and grade of the tumor is low and early,survival is good.
